32 и 86 разрядные системы в чем разница


В наше время компьютеры стали неотъемлемой частью нашей жизни. Однако, при выборе компьютерной системы мы сталкиваемся с множеством технических терминов, которые не всем знакомы. Одним из таких терминов является «разрядность».

Разрядность системы – это количество битов, которое она может обрабатывать за одну операцию. Сейчас наиболее распространены две разрядности: 32 и 64 бита. Отличить их можно по архитектуре процессора. Но в чем же заключается разница между ними?

Основное отличие между 32 и 64 разрядными системами заключается в их возможностях по обработке информации. 32 бита позволяют обработать максимум 4 гигабайта оперативной памяти, тогда как 64 бита позволяют обрабатывать десятки петабайт оперативной памяти. Благодаря этому, 64 разрядные системы могут работать более эффективно с большими объемами данных и приложениями, требующими большого количества оперативной памяти.

Кроме того, 64 разрядные системы обладают более высокой производительностью по сравнению с 32 разрядными системами. Их процессоры могут выполнять более сложные операции и обрабатывать больший объем данных за одну операцию. Это особенно важно для многозадачных программ и игр, которые требуют большого количества вычислительных операций.

32 и 86 разрядные системы: отличия и преимущества

32-разрядная система работает с 32-битными данными, что позволяет обрабатывать информацию объемом до 4 гигабайт. Она обеспечивает сравнительно низкое потребление памяти, что делает ее привлекательной для использования в небольших устройствах с ограниченными ресурсами. Однако, из-за ограничения на объем доступной памяти, 32-разрядные системы не могут полноценно использовать потенциал современных большегрузных программ и операционных систем.

86-разрядная система работает с 64-битными данными, что позволяет обрабатывать информацию объемом до 18,4 миллиона терабайт. Она способна обрабатывать и управлять большим объемом данных и обладает высокой скоростью выполнения операций. Кроме того, 86-разрядные системы могут использовать более 4 гигабайт оперативной памяти, что делает их идеальным выбором для современных приложений и операционных систем.

Основное отличие между 32 и 86 разрядными системами заключается в их возможностях обработки информации и использовании доступной памяти. 32-разрядные системы обычно применяются в небольших устройствах с ограниченными ресурсами, в то время как 86-разрядные системы способны обрабатывать больший объем данных и использовать более 4 гигабайт оперативной памяти. При выборе системы необходимо учитывать требования приложений и операционных систем, которые будут использоваться в рамках проекта.

Что такое 32 и 86 разрядные системы

В 32-битных системах процессор использует 32-битные адреса для доступа к памяти. Это означает, что максимальное количество адресуемой памяти составляет 4 гигабайта (2^32 байт). Для целочисленных значений 32-битные системы могут использовать операции с целыми числами размером до 32 бит.

86-битные системы, также известные как x86-64 или 64-битные системы, используют 64-битные адреса и целочисленные значения. Это обеспечивает гораздо большую адресуемую память, которая составляет до 18446744073709551616 байт, или 16 эксабайт. Более того, 64-битные системы предоставляют возможность работы с более широким набором данных, таких как двоичные, вещественные числа и символы.

Основное преимущество 32-битных систем заключается в их совместимости со старым программным обеспечением, которое не может работать на 64-битных системах. Однако, ввиду ограничений на объем адресуемой памяти, 32-битные системы могут оперировать с ограниченными данными и ресурсами. 64-битные системы же обеспечивают более высокую производительность и могут эффективно использовать память и ресурсы для более крупных и сложных задач.

Характеристика32-битные системы64-битные системы
Максимальный объем памяти4 ГБ16 ЭБ
Максимальный объем целочисленных значений32 бита64 бита
Совместимость со старым ПОВысокаяОграниченная
ПроизводительностьОграниченнаяВысокая

Главные отличия между 32 и 86 разрядными системами

Адресная память: Ещё одно отличие между этими системами – это количество адресной памяти, которое они могут обрабатывать. 32-разрядные системы могут работать с максимально 4 гигабайтами адресного пространства, в то время как 86-разрядные системы могут обрабатывать большие объемы памяти, достигающие 18.4 требайтов.

Производительность: Из-за различий в архитектуре и адресной памяти, 86-разрядные системы часто обладают более высокой производительностью и могут обрабатывать более сложные задачи. Это особенно заметно при работе с большими объемами данных, визуализацией 3D-графики или выполнении сложных математических операций.

Обратная совместимость: 86-разрядные системы поддерживают как 32-разрядное, так и 64-разрядное программное обеспечение, в то время как 32-разрядные системы не могут исполнять программы, предназначенные для 86-разрядных систем. Это может быть ограничением при выборе программного обеспечения и драйверов для 32-разрядных систем.

Управление памятью: 86-разрядные системы поддерживают более высокую емкость физической памяти, что позволяет запускать больше программ одновременно и работать с более сложными задачами. Они также имеют более эффективные механизмы управления памятью, что повышает общую производительность системы.

Расширяемость: 86-разрядные системы часто имеют более развитую возможность расширения путем подключения новых устройств, таких как дополнительные жесткие диски, графические карты или периферийные устройства. Они также имеют более широкую поддержку для новых технологий и функций, что делает их более гибкими в использовании.

Совместимость программного обеспечения: 32-разрядные системы поддерживают большинство программного обеспечения, которое существует на рынке, но многие новые программы и игры могут быть оптимизированы для работы на 86-разрядных системах. Это связано с тем, что 86-разрядные системы обладают более высокой производительностью и возможностями, которые могут быть использованы разработчиками программного обеспечения.

Цена: На данный момент 32-разрядные системы дешевле 86-разрядных систем из-за их меньшей производительности и возможностей. Однако с развитием технологий и увеличением спроса на более мощные системы, 86-разрядные системы становятся все более доступными и широко используемыми.

Преимущества 32 разрядных систем

32 разрядные системы имеют ряд преимуществ, которые делают их привлекательными для определенных сценариев использования:

  1. Низкая стоимость: 32 разрядные системы являются более доступными с точки зрения стоимости по сравнению с 64 разрядными системами. Это может быть важно для тех, кто не нуждается в мощных вычислительных ресурсах.
  2. Совместимость: программы, разработанные для 32 разрядных систем, могут запускаться на 64 разрядных системах. Это позволяет эффективно использовать существующие приложения, не требуя их полной переработки.
  3. Энергоэффективность: 32 разрядные системы обычно потребляют меньше энергии, чем их 64 разрядные аналоги. Это может быть важным аспектом при выборе системы для работы на батарейках или в условиях ограниченного электропитания.
  4. Лучшая совместимость с устаревшими программами: некоторые старые приложения могут не работать на 64 разрядных системах из-за отсутствия поддержки 32 разрядных библиотек. В таких случаях 32 разрядные системы могут быть предпочтительнее.
  5. Совместимость с ограниченными ресурсами: 32 разрядные системы требуют меньше оперативной памяти и места на жестком диске. Это делает их идеальным выбором для устройств с ограниченными ресурсами, таких как ноутбуки и планшеты.

В целом, 32 разрядные системы остаются полезными в ряде сценариев использования, где требуется надежная, экономичная и энергоэффективная платформа.

Преимущества 86 разрядных систем

86 разрядные системы имеют несколько важных преимуществ перед 32 разрядными системами. Вот основные из них:

  1. Более высокая производительность: 86 разрядные системы способны обрабатывать большие объемы данных и выполнять сложные вычисления быстрее, чем 32 разрядные системы. Большая ширина данных и адресного пространства позволяют более эффективно использовать ресурсы и повышать общую скорость работы.
  2. Поддержка большего объема оперативной памяти: 86 разрядные системы способны адресовать значительно больший объем оперативной памяти, чем 32 разрядные системы. Это позволяет запускать более требовательные и ресурсоемкие приложения, которым требуется больше памяти для эффективной работы.
  3. Лучшая совместимость с современным программным обеспечением: Большинство современного программного обеспечения разрабатывается и оптимизируется для работы на 86 разрядных системах. Использование 86 разрядной архитектуры позволяет получить доступ к более широкому спектру программ и обеспечить лучшую совместимость с операционными системами и приложениями.
  4. Поддержка новых технологий и инструкций: 86 разрядные системы поддерживают более новые технологии и наборы инструкций, что позволяет использовать более продвинутые функции и возможности в программном обеспечении. Такие технологии, как виртуализация, аппаратное ускорение и расширения набора инструкций, доступны только на 86 разрядных системах.
  5. Лучшая поддержка мультимедиа: Благодаря более высокой производительности и расширенным возможностям инструкций, 86 разрядные системы обладают лучшей поддержкой мультимедиа. Они способны более эффективно обрабатывать графические, звуковые и видеоданные, что позволяет запускать более качественные и требовательные по ресурсам мультимедийные приложения.

В целом, 86 разрядные системы предлагают более высокую производительность, больший объем памяти, лучшую совместимость с программным обеспечением, поддержку новых технологий и расширенных возможностей мультимедиа. Именно поэтому они являются предпочтительным выбором для многих пользователей и разработчиков.

Выбор между 32 и 64 разрядными системами

При выборе операционной системы для вашего компьютера одним из ключевых вопросов становится выбор между 32 и 64 разрядными системами. В данном разделе мы рассмотрим основные отличия и преимущества каждого из вариантов, чтобы помочь вам сделать правильный выбор.

32 разрядные системы:

32 разрядные системы поддерживают максимально 4 гигабайта оперативной памяти. Это означает, что если у вас установлено больше 4 гигабайт ОЗУ, то не весь объем будет использоваться операционной системой. В отличие от 64 разрядных систем, 32 разрядные системы не могут использовать полное потенциальное преимущество более современных компьютерных технологий.

64 разрядные системы:

64 разрядные системы, в свою очередь, могут использовать всю доступную оперативную память и обеспечивают более быструю обработку данных. Они также более устойчивы к сбоям и ошибкам, благодаря улучшенной архитектуре и возможности работы с большим объемом информации.

Важным фактором при выборе между 32 и 64 разрядными системами является совместимость с установленным программным обеспечением. Если у вас есть 32 разрядные приложения, которые необходимо использовать, то вам следует остановиться на 32 разрядной системе. Однако, если вы планируете использовать современное программное обеспечение, которое может эффективно работать только на 64 разрядных системах, то выбор будет в пользу 64 разрядной системы.

Заключение:

В общем, выбор между 32 и 64 разрядными системами зависит от ваших потребностей и требований. Если вам нужна поддержка большого объема оперативной памяти и быстрая обработка данных, то 64 разрядная система будет лучшим выбором. Если ваше программное обеспечение требует 32 разрядных приложений или у вас ограниченное количество оперативной памяти, то следует остановиться на 32 разрядной системе.

Имейте в виду, что большинство современных компьютеров и операционных систем предлагают поддержку 64 разрядных систем, и в будущем все больше приложений будет нацелено на эту архитектуру.

Добавить комментарий

Вам также может понравиться